From the outside, this classic 1930s bay-fronted home on Tixall Road looks pretty unassuming… but the moment you step inside, you realise there's a whole lot more going on. This place has been carefully loved, thoughtfully improved and brought up to an exceptional standard by its current custodians — and you really can feel that story unfold as you walk through.


The front lounge is the first room to greet you, and it's instantly inviting. The log burner sets the tone, the décor is calm and considered, and the room has this gentle, peaceful energy that makes you want to curl up and stay a while. It's the perfect space to switch off, shut the door and enjoy some proper downtime.


But if that door's open, you'll almost glide straight past and into the real social heart of the home — the open kitchen/diner. The owners have completely transformed this space, and it shows. It's bright, stylish and genuinely made for hosting, with plenty of room for a big dining table and a natural flow that keeps everyone connected. Sliding doors lead straight out to the patio, and there's also handy side access via the carport. It's the kind of room that works just as well for lazy Sunday brunches as it does for lively evenings with friends.


Upstairs carries that same thoughtful attention to detail. The bathroom is up first and feels surprisingly generous. It has a calm, spa-like feel that makes both the rushed morning routines and the slow, indulgent evening soaks feel equally at home.


Bedroom 2 is a lovely, comfortable double room. The neutral palette, soft textures and panelling give it a serene feel, and it's exactly the kind of space guests settle into instantly — maybe a little too happily!


The master bedroom mirrors the footprint of bedroom 2 but gains the charm of the 1930s bay window. It adds space, light and character, and the current owners have styled it in a way that really shows how elegant this room can be.


The third bedroom — the famous “box room” — has been used brilliantly. It's currently set up as a work-from-home space, but it still functions perfectly well as a single bedroom when needed, proving that every inch of this house has been made to work practically.


Now, the garden… this is where this home really surprises you. The patio sits directly off the dining room and is a fantastic spot to enjoy a coffee or unwind after work. Down the steps, you enter a very mature, established garden with greenery, colour and a real sense of privacy. Follow the garden down further and you come to the hidden ‘secret' section — a quiet lawned area with decking and a fantastic garden room. Whether you picture a bar, games den, relaxing hideout, creative studio, or gaming HQ for the kids, this space is ready to become whatever you need it to be.
